
Cost of Rainwater Diversion in Medina
Rainwater diversion is an essential practice for homeowners in Medina, OH, seeking to manage stormwater effectively and sustainably. By redirecting rainwater from roofs and other surfaces, residents can prevent flooding, reduce soil erosion, and even collect water for reuse. However, the cost of implementing a rainwater diversion system can vary widely based on several factors.
Factors Affecting Cost
- System Type: The choice between a simple gutter system and a more complex rainwater harvesting setup can significantly influence costs.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ials, such as stainless steel or copper, tend to be more expensive than basic plastic options.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Medina, OH, can vary, impacting the overall cost of installation.
- System Size: Larger systems designed to handle more water will generally be more costly.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Landscaping Adjustments: Modifications to existing landscaping for optimal water diversion can increase costs.
- Maintenance Requirements: Systems that require frequent maintenance or specialized care can incur additional ongoing cost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(in Medina, OH) |
---|---|
Basic Gutter Installation | $600 - $1,200 |
Advanced Rainwater Harvesting System |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Downspout Extensions | $100 - $300 per downspout |
Rain Barrels | $80 - $200 per barrel |
French Drain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spection Fees | $50 - $200 |
Landscaping Adjustments | $500 - $2,000 |
